Matching the interaction at two-loops
arXiv:1405.6226 · doi:10.1007/JHEP01(2015)031
Abstract
The coefficient of the interaction in the low energy expansion of the two-loop four-graviton amplitude in type II superstring theory is known to be proportional to the integral of the Zhang-Kawazumi (ZK) invariant over the moduli space of genus-two Riemann surfaces. We demonstrate that the ZK invariant is an eigenfunction with eigenvalue 5 of the Laplace-Beltrami operator in the interior of moduli space. Exploiting this result, we evaluate the integral of the ZK invariant explicitly, finding agreement with the value of the two-loop interaction predicted on the basis of S-duality and supersymmetry. A review of the current understanding of the interactions in type II superstring theory compactified on a torus with and is included.
